    My header has always been 1100px, to perfectly fit the layout dimension.
    After the update, or i do not know what happened, if i go to Mantra Settings —> Layout Setting i can’t anymore set the dimension of the content and sidebar. If i move the bar that set the dimension in PX of the content and side bar, the numbers of the dimensions don’t change at all.
    And i do not know what happened, but the entire layout seems to be more then classic 1100px, and the header image in smaller than the original template dimension.
    I did not modify any code or anything else…

    This was a temporary issue with Mantra and WP 3.6. It is fixed in Mantra 2.0.7.1

    The site width is 50px wider than the configured layout width (due to some extra padding needed). When you define your header image, WordPress indicates the correct sizes (including those 50px).
